Sky Sports will show the US Open Championship for a further three years as part of a partnership extension with the USGA.

That will include the 2023 contest at Los Angeles Country Club in California from June 15-18, the 2024 contest at Pinehurst and the 2025 event at Oakmont.

The new deal also covers the US Women’s Open and a host of other USGA events.

The US Amateur Championship and US Women’s Amateur Championship will also be shown live, along with the US Senior Open.

Sky Sports will broadcast a ton of golf this year, including The Open, the Solheim Cup, and this week’s PGA Championship.
